Description

Viola Mitchell helped operate her family's store, Mitchells Emporium and Dry Goods. While ordering new stock for the store's shelves, she met traveling salesman, John Jasper. Viola was intrigued by John's charm and charisma. Later, she discovered his cruelty and callousness.

Viola lived in Everstille, Indiana, a small, flourishing town where she struggled with decisions and actions which, she hoped, were socially acceptable. And moral.

Everstille, A Novel, is set in the early part of the twentieth century and recounts the lives of Viola, her family and friends, and her twin sons, Michael and Mitchell. The novel divulges the joys, sorrows, and unexpected revelations of its characters.
